Field Trips

  • Field trips play a crucial role in enhancing the educational experience for students at the Conservatory for the Arts. These excursions go beyond the traditional classroom setting, offering unique opportunities for students to immerse themselves in the world of the arts and beyond. The benefits of field trips extend to various aspects of their education, including a deeper understanding of the arts, connections with other subjects, and an increased awareness of the environment.
